It’s back to school and back to more terrible polling for Sunak. Deltapoll’s latest poll puts Rishi at -43%, a drop by 8 percentage points in the last week. Starmer has managed to climb back up by 5 percentage points to -2%, despite Labour’s tumultuous last week. This latest poll is the widest gap between the two leaders they’ve ever seen…
In terms of voting intention, the gap between Labour and the Tories now stand at 21 percentage points, with Labour at 48% and Conservatives 27%. Meanwhile, Judith McAlpine, a prominent Tory donor, has come out saying she’ll have “real trouble” voting for the party.
